位置:excel百科网-关于excel知识普及与知识讲解 > 资讯中心 > excel百科 > 文章详情

excel数据怎么导入mysql

作者:excel百科网
|
215人看过
发布时间:2026-01-10 08:14:24
标签:
excel数据怎么导入mysql在信息化时代,数据的管理和分析已经成为企业运营的重要组成部分。Excel作为一款强大的数据处理工具,广泛应用于企业日常运营和数据分析。而MySQL作为一款开源的关系型数据库管理系统,也在企业中扮演着不可
excel数据怎么导入mysql
excel数据怎么导入mysql
在信息化时代,数据的管理和分析已经成为企业运营的重要组成部分。Excel作为一款强大的数据处理工具,广泛应用于企业日常运营和数据分析。而MySQL作为一款开源的关系型数据库管理系统,也在企业中扮演着不可或缺的角色。因此,如何将Excel数据导入MySQL,成为许多用户关心的问题。
Excel和MySQL在数据处理和存储方面各有优势。Excel适合进行数据的初步处理、图表制作和快速分析,而MySQL则更适合长期存储和复杂查询。因此,将Excel数据导入MySQL,不仅能够实现数据的整合,还能提升数据的可用性和查询效率。
一、Excel数据导入MySQL的基本概念
Excel数据导入MySQL的过程,本质上是数据的迁移和转换。在这一过程中,Excel中的数据需要被解析,并根据MySQL的结构进行存储。Excel文件通常以.xlsx或.xls格式存在,而MySQL则以.sql文件、表结构定义或直接通过数据库连接进行数据导入。
在导入过程中,需要考虑数据的类型、格式、字段数量以及数据的一致性。不同来源的数据在格式上可能存在差异,因此在导入前需要进行数据清洗和格式转换。
二、Excel数据导入MySQL的准备工作
在进行Excel数据导入MySQL之前,需要做好充分的准备工作。首先,确认MySQL的安装和配置是否正确,确保数据库服务已经启动,并且有相应的用户权限。其次,需要确认MySQL的表结构是否与Excel中的数据结构一致,如果结构不一致,可能需要进行数据转换。
接下来,需要确保Excel文件的格式是兼容的,例如使用.xlsx或.xls格式,并且文件内容没有损坏。此外,还需要考虑数据的完整性,确保导入的数据没有缺失或错误。
三、Excel数据导入MySQL的步骤
Excel数据导入MySQL的步骤可以分为以下几个阶段:
1. 数据提取:从Excel文件中提取所需的数据,并确保数据的完整性和一致性。
2. 数据清洗:对提取的数据进行清洗,去除重复的数据,处理缺失值,确保数据的准确性。
3. 数据转换:根据MySQL的表结构,将Excel中的数据转换为MySQL的格式,包括字段类型、数据长度等。
4. 数据导入:将转换后的数据导入MySQL数据库,可以选择使用SQL语句直接导入,或者使用MySQL的导入工具。
5. 数据验证:导入完成后,对数据进行验证,确保数据的完整性、准确性和一致性。
四、Excel数据导入MySQL的工具和方法
Excel数据导入MySQL的方法有多种,不同的方法适用于不同的场景。以下是几种常见的方法:
1. 使用MySQL Workbench:MySQL Workbench是MySQL官方提供的数据库管理工具,支持直接导入Excel数据。用户可以通过“Data”选项卡,选择“Import”功能,将Excel文件导入到MySQL数据库中。
2. 使用SQL语句:通过编写SQL语句,将Excel文件中的数据导入到MySQL数据库中。用户需要先将Excel文件转换为SQL格式,然后执行SQL语句。
3. 使用第三方工具:如DataGrip、Toad for MySQL等,这些工具提供了更便捷的数据导入功能,支持多种数据源,包括Excel。
4. 使用Python脚本:Python是一门强大的编程语言,可以通过Python脚本实现Excel数据到MySQL的导入。用户可以使用pandas库读取Excel文件,然后使用mysql-connector-python库将数据导入MySQL数据库。
五、Excel数据导入MySQL的注意事项
在进行Excel数据导入MySQL的过程中,需要注意以下几个事项:
1. 数据格式一致性:确保Excel中的数据格式与MySQL的表结构一致,否则可能会导致数据导入失败。
2. 数据完整性:在导入前,确保数据没有缺失或错误,否则可能会导致导入后的数据不完整。
3. 数据安全性:在导入数据时,要注意数据的安全性,防止数据泄露。
4. 性能优化:在大规模数据导入时,需要注意数据库的性能优化,确保导入过程的顺利进行。
六、Excel数据导入MySQL的实际应用
Excel数据导入MySQL在实际应用中有着广泛的应用场景。例如,企业可以将销售数据导入MySQL数据库,进行数据分析和报表生成;医院可以将患者数据导入MySQL数据库,进行医疗管理;教育机构可以将课程数据导入MySQL数据库,进行教学管理。
在实际操作中,企业通常会根据自身的需求,选择合适的导入方法。例如,对于小规模的数据,可以使用Excel直接导入MySQL;对于大规模的数据,可以使用Python脚本进行批量导入,以提高效率。
七、Excel数据导入MySQL的挑战与解决方案
在实际操作中,Excel数据导入MySQL可能会遇到一些挑战。例如,数据格式不一致、数据量过大、数据缺失等问题。针对这些问题,可以采取以下解决方案:
1. 数据格式不一致:可以通过数据清洗工具,将Excel中的数据转换为统一的格式。
2. 数据量过大:可以使用分批次导入的方法,将数据分成多个批次,逐步导入到MySQL数据库中。
3. 数据缺失:可以通过数据填充工具,填补缺失的数据,确保数据的完整性。
八、Excel数据导入MySQL的未来发展趋势
随着技术的发展,Excel数据导入MySQL的方式也在不断演进。未来,可能会出现更加智能化的数据导入工具,能够自动识别数据格式,自动进行数据清洗和转换,提高数据导入的效率和准确性。
此外,随着云计算和大数据技术的发展,数据导入的方式也将更加多样化,企业可以利用云平台进行数据迁移和管理,提升数据处理的灵活性和效率。
九、总结
Excel数据导入MySQL是一项重要的数据管理任务,它不仅能够实现数据的整合,还能提升数据的可用性和查询效率。在实际操作中,需要根据具体需求选择合适的方法,并注意数据的安全性和完整性。随着技术的发展,数据导入的方式也将不断优化,为企业提供更加高效的数据管理解决方案。
通过合理的规划和操作,企业可以充分利用Excel和MySQL的优势,实现数据的高效管理和分析,为业务发展提供有力支持。
推荐文章
相关文章
推荐URL
Excel数据透视表中筛选的深度解析与实用技巧 在Excel中,数据透视表是一种强大的数据整理与分析工具,它能够将复杂的数据集进行分类汇总,使用户能够快速了解数据的分布、趋势和关系。然而,数据透视表的真正价值不仅在于汇总数据,更在于
2026-01-10 08:14:24
310人看过
Excel中怎么把横排变成竖排:实用方法与技巧详解在Excel中,数据的排列方式直接影响到数据的清晰度和可读性。在日常工作中,我们经常需要将横向排列的数据转换为纵向排列,比如将一列数据变为一行数据,或者将多列数据变为多行数据。本文将详
2026-01-10 08:14:15
198人看过
excel复制word文档:实用技巧与深度解析在现代办公环境中,Excel和Word是两种常用的数据处理与文档编辑工具。Excel主要用于数据计算、图表制作和表格管理,而Word则侧重于文本编辑、排版和文档制作。在实际工作中,经常需要
2026-01-10 08:14:02
243人看过
Excel数据有效性自定义:提升数据管理效率的实用指南Excel 是一款广泛应用于数据处理和管理的办公软件,其强大的功能使其成为企业、个人和开发者不可或缺的工具。然而,Excel 的数据有效性功能在实际应用中往往被忽视,导致数据输入错
2026-01-10 08:14:00
389人看过
热门推荐
热门专题:
资讯中心: